Summary

This document appears to be a page from a memo or letter written by an Israeli Minister of Defense (likely Ehud Barak given the timeline and role). The author argues for a strong Israel that is allied with the US but willing to negotiate with Palestinians based on a modified Arab League Plan. The text emphasizes the critical nature of repairing and maintaining US-Israel relations and mentions past meetings with Presidents Obama and Bush.

A precondition to seize such an opportunity is a
mighty, sober, self confident Israel, in strong
alliance with the US. An Israel which can deter or
defeat any combination of regional powers, yet, an
Israel who is ready to contemplate and consider a
modified Saudi or Arab League Plan as a basis for
negotiations.
The unique relationship we have developed with
the US over the last 45yrs based on common
values ,mutual respect and shared interests is a
cornerstone of our strength, world posture and
our future. It is also a crucial building block of any
regional peace and cooperation strategy.Allowing
IL/US relations to remain damaged , I believe is a
grave mistake with potentially far reaching
consequences.
